Siliguri APMC Emerges as Top Mandi for Rice Prices Today

Rice recorded the highest prices today in Siliguri APMC mandi on 24 Mar 2026.

📂 Mandi Updates • ✍️ Amit • 🕒

On 24 Mar 2026, Siliguri APMC emerged as the top-performing mandi for Rice, recording the highest traded price of ₹4,900 per quintal. Among all reporting markets, this mandi outperformed peers, setting the benchmark for the day.

When a single mandi leads the price chart across the network, it signals strong competitive bidding, quality arrivals, and robust buyer participation rather than isolated transactions.

Siliguri APMC – Competitive Market Leadership

  • Commodity: Rice
  • Date: 24 Mar 2026
  • Highest Recorded Price: ₹4,900
  • Average Trading Price: ₹4,162
  • Total Active Mandis: 5

A strong average alongside the highest price indicates that the leadership is supported by broader trading strength, not just one or two premium deals. Such performance often reflects higher-quality produce, better logistics, or stronger procurement demand in this mandi.

Comparison with Other Major Mandis

MandiPrice (₹ per quintal)
Siliguri APMC₹4,900
Durgapur APMC₹4,785
Tamluk (Medinipur E) APMC₹4,400
Kolaghat APMC₹4,400
Tamluk (Medinipur E) APMC₹3,700
Kolaghat APMC₹3,700
Dasda APMC₹3,250

The comparison above clearly shows that Siliguri APMC maintained a price edge over other markets. In such cases, the leading mandi often becomes a reference point for regional price discovery.
